Transaction 5650861eeb99ef1e06894489205d700386219d876381dd2c3b940c65cf82e5c3
1 Input
1 Output
-
5650861eeb99ef1e06894489205d700386219d876381dd2c3b940c65cf82e5c3:0
- value
- 1009840
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c353392bc1fd1b09ab1c8a782c3d5959c1187d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KckadroUdykN8xJEE6PiX8MXkeurhY9fW